"intramandibular" meaning in English

See intramandibular in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Adjective

Rhymes: -ɪbjʊlə(ɹ) Etymology: intra- + mandibular Etymology templates: {{prefix|en|intra|mandibular}} intra- + mandibular Head templates: {{en-adj|-}} intramandibular (not comparable)
  1. Within a mandible Tags: not-comparable
